The Brotherhood (1968)

Movie ★ 6.1 96 min

The son of a powerful Mafia don comes home from his army service in Vietnam and wants to lead his own life, but family tradition, intrigues and powerplays involving his older brother dictate otherwise, and he finds himself being slowly drawn back into that world.

Martin Ritt Director Lewis John Carlino Writer
